repo.or.cz
/
eleutheria.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Add htable_stat_get_chain_len()
2007-11-19
Stathis Kamperis
Add
htable_stat_get_cha
i
n_len(
)
commit
|
commitdiff
|
tree
2007-11-17
St
a
thi
s
Kamperi
s
D
on't
forget to
i
nitialize htable->h
t
_grows
commit
|
commitdiff
|
tree
2007-11-17
Stathis Kamperis
Add
s
tats to trac
k
a
utomatic re
s
i
zes (grows)
commit
|
commitdiff
|
tree
2007-11-17
Stathis Kamper
i
s
Cosmetic change i
n
co
m
ment
commit
|
commitdiff
|
tree
2007-11-02
Stathis Kamperis
R
et
u
rn NUL
L
when no f
i
rst usable
i
t
e
m
can be found
commit
|
commitdiff
|
tree
2007-10-24
S
tathi
s
Kamperis
F
ix typo in argument list
commit
|
commitdiff
|
tree
2007-10-23
Stathis Kampe
r
i
s
Mult
i
p
ly and do
n
't divide by 2 when
g
r
owing
.
.
.
commit
|
commitdiff
|
tree
2007-10-23
Stathis Kamperis
More
c
leanup, most
l
y comm
e
nts
commit
|
commitdiff
|
tree
2007-10-23
S
tathis Kamperis
A
d
d so
m
e com
m
ents
commit
|
commitdiff
|
tree
2007-10-23
S
t
athis K
a
mperis
Ge
n
eral cl
e
anu
p
commit
|
commitdiff
|
tree
2007-09-20
S
t
a
this Kamperis
Don't check < 0 for unsigned ex
p
res
s
ion
commit
|
commitdiff
|
tree
2007-09-20
S
t
athis Kamperis
M
e
r
ge h
t
able_get_first_elm()
i
n
h
tab
l
e_get_next_elm()
commit
|
commitdiff
|
tree
2007-09-20
S
tathis Kamper
i
s
Add htable_get_fir
s
t/next_element() functions for htable
.
.
.
commit
|
commitdiff
|
tree
2007-09-19
S
t
ath
i
s Kamp
e
r
i
s
Add
t
est
ca
s
e for htable_
t
raverse
commit
|
commitdiff
|
tree
2007-09-19
Stathis Kam
p
e
r
is
Add htab
l
e_get_s
i
ze(),
htable_get_used(), hta
b
l
e_traver
s
e()
commit
|
commitdiff
|
tree
2007-09-19
S
tathi
s
Kamperis
A
dd st
u
b for htable_get_n
e
xt_
e
lm()
commit
|
commitdiff
|
tree
2007-09-19
Stathis Kamperis
Fix typo in comme
n
t
commit
|
commitdiff
|
tree
2007-09-14
Sta
t
h
i
s Kamp
e
ris
Add flags HT_FREEKEY a
n
d HT
_
FREEDATA in ht
a
ble_free
_
*()
commit
|
commitdiff
|
tree
2007-09-11
Stathis K
a
mperis
htab
l
e_
f
ree_objects() -> hta
b
le_free_all_obj() in
m
ain
.
c
commit
|
commitdiff
|
tree
2007-09-11
S
tathis Kamperis
pr
i
ntf cal
l
back -> mypr
i
n
t
f so
a
s no
t
to sha
d
o
w st
d
io
.
.
.
commit
|
commitdiff
|
tree
2007-09-11
Stathis Kamperis
Remove r
e
d
u
nda
n
t , when in enumeration
l
i
s
t
commit
|
commitdiff
|
tree
2007-09-10
S
t
ath
i
s Kamper
i
s
HT_REPLACE
D
-> HT_E
X
ISTS
commit
|
commitdiff
|
tree
2007-09-10
Stathis K
a
mperis
Implement
htab
l
e_f
r
ee_obj(
)
fun
c
tion
commit
|
commitdiff
|
tree
2007-09-10
Stathis Kamperis
ht
a
b
l
e
_
ins
e
rt() doesn't ovewrite e
x
isting
d
ata
commit
|
commitdiff
|
tree
2007-09-10
Stathis Kamperis
htable_inser
t
() returns HT
_
REPLACED
if key already
.
.
.
commit
|
commitdiff
|
tree
2007-09-10
St
a
this
K
amperis
Free
h
n_key
commit
|
commitdiff
|
tree
2007-09-10
S
t
athis Kamperis
Free old data when inser
t
ing new en
t
r
y with existing key
commit
|
commitdiff
|
tree
2007-09-09
Stathis Kamper
i
s
Add
htable_fr
e
e_objects() th
a
frees pnod
e
->data
commit
|
commitdiff
|
tree
2007-09-09
Stat
h
is Kamperi
s
P
a
s
s callback
function in htable_init()
commit
|
commitdiff
|
tree
2007-09-09
Stathis K
a
mperis
#include <st
d
def
.
h
>
in
htable
.
h
for size_t type
commit
|
commitdiff
|
tree
2007-09-09
Stathis Kam
p
e
ris
htabl
e
_gr
o
w() should return HT_OK on s
u
ccess
commit
|
commitdiff
|
tree
2007-09-08
Stat
h
i
s
Kamperis
Add comment
commit
|
commitdiff
|
tree
2007-09-08
Stathis Kamperis
Constify var
i
abl
e
in htable
_
pr
i
nt()
commit
|
commitdiff
|
tree
2007-09-08
S
tathis
Kam
p
eris
Ad
d
htabl
e
_grow()
commit
|
commitdiff
|
tree
2007-09-08
S
t
athi
s
K
a
m
peris
u_int ->
u
n
s
i
gn
e
d
int
commit
|
commitdiff
|
tree
2007-09-08
Stathis
K
amper
i
s
Add comment in
main
(
)
commit
|
commitdiff
|
tree
2007-09-08
Stathis K
a
mperis
changes i
n
djb_hash
commit
|
commitdiff
|
tree
2007-09-08
Stathis Kamper
i
s
Constify some variabl
e
s
commit
|
commitdiff
|
tree
2007-09-08
Stat
h
is
K
am
p
eris
Add
a hhead_t typedef fo
r
struct h
t
ablehead
commit
|
commitdiff
|
tree
2007-09-08
Sta
t
his Kamperis
Add
p
roper e
r
ror hand
l
i
ng in htable_*() functio
n
s
commit
|
commitdiff
|
tree
2007-09-07
St
a
this Kamperis
ptable -> ht
a
ble in main
.
c
commit
|
commitdiff
|
tree
2007-09-07
S
t
a
this
Kampe
r
i
s
A
dd htab
l
e_
f
ree() and don't forget
t
o u
p
da
t
e ht_size
.
.
.
commit
|
commitdiff
|
tree
2007-09-07
Stathis Kamperis
Rename h
t
able_delete() to htable_re
m
ove()
commit
|
commitdiff
|
tree
2007-09-07
Stathis
K
a
m
peris
Fix t
y
po and remov
e
whites
p
ace
commit
|
commitdiff
|
tree
2007-09-07
St
a
t
his Kamperis
Fix comment
i
n prev
i
ous commit
commit
|
commitdiff
|
tree
2007-09-07
Stathis
Kam
p
eris
Add h
t
able_d
e
lete() function
commit
|
commitdiff
|
tree
2007-09-07
Stathis Kamperis
str -> key
i
n
d
j
b
_
h
ash() function
commit
|
commitdiff
|
tree
2007-09-07
Stathis
Kampe
r
is
In
c
l
u
de argum
e
nts' names in
func
t
ion prototy
p
es
commit
|
commitdiff
|
tree
2007-09-07
Sta
t
his
K
am
p
eris
pass void *ke
y
argumen
t
i
n
h
t
able_print()
commit
|
commitdiff
|
tree
2007-09-07
Stathis Kamperi
s
Add commen
t
s
f
or ht_size variable
commit
|
commitdiff
|
tree
2007-09-07
St
a
this Kamperis
Constify variab
l
e in htable_
p
rint
(
)
commit
|
commitdiff
|
tree
2007-09-07
Sta
t
his
K
am
p
eris
Move htable files to hta
b
le/ subdire
c
t
o
r
y
commit
|
commitdiff
|
tree
2007-09-07
Stathis Ka
m
p
e
ri
s
Split htable implemen
t
ation to hta
b
le
.
c and htable
.
.
.
commit
|
commitdiff
|
tree
2007-09-07
Stath
i
s
Kampe
r
is
Add
s
om
e
c
o
mments
commit
|
commitdiff
|
tree
2007-09-07
Stathis Kamperis
Constify some
v
aria
b
l
es
commit
|
commitdiff
|
tree
2007-09-07
Sta
t
his Kamperis
ht
_
printf()
has a
v
oid *data arg
u
ment
commit
|
commitdiff
|
tree
2007-09-07
Stathis
h
t_cmpf
(
)
return
s
0 if args are equal
commit
|
commitdiff
|
tree
2007-09-06
Stathis
Add callba
c
k f
u
nctions for
hash, compare and prin
t
commit
|
commitdiff
|
tree
2007-09-06
S
t
athi
s
Ad
d
h
table_lookup(
)
commit
|
commitdiff
|
tree
2007-09-06
Stathis
Fix a
s
e
gfault
commit
|
commitdiff
|
tree
2007-09-06
Sta
t
his
Fi
x
b
u
ffer overr
u
ns
commit
|
commitdiff
|
tree
2007-09-06
Stathis
Constify variable
commit
|
commitdiff
|
tree
2007-09-05
Stathis
Fix minor
g
r
a
mmat
i
c
a
l e
r
r
o
r
in comment
commit
|
commitdiff
|
tree
2007-09-05
S
t
athis
Remove w
h
itespace
commit
|
commitdiff
|
tree
2007-09-05
Stat
h
is
Con
s
tify some variables
commit
|
commitdiff
|
tree
2007-09-05
S
t
athis
M
erge branc
h
'mas
t
er'
o
f git+ssh://repo
.
or
.
cz/sr
v
/git
.
.
.
commit
|
commitdiff
|
tree
2007-09-05
Sta
t
h
i
s
Make
htabl
e
_*
function
s
,
hash table size agnostic
commit
|
commitdiff
|
tree
2007-09-05
Sta
t
his
M
ake htable_* function
s
,
hast table size agnos
t
ic
commit
|
commitdiff
|
tree
2007-09-05
Stathis
Add comment
s
to s
o
urce
commit
|
commitdiff
|
tree
2007-09-05
Stathis
Fix hopefully all segfaults :)
commit
|
commitdiff
|
tree
2007-09-05
Stathis
Fix chainin
g
a
nd ad
d
htable_print()
commit
|
commitdiff
|
tree
2007-08-30
Stath
i
s Kamperis
Fix a memo
r
y leak in
tail
q
.
c
commit
|
commitdiff
|
tree
2007-08-30
Stathis Kamperis
Merge bra
n
ch 'm
a
s
t
er' of git+ssh://Beket@repo
.
or
.
cz
.
.
.
commit
|
commitdiff
|
tree
2007-08-30
S
t
athis Kamperis
Fix a
memory leak
in
slinke
d
list
.
c fil
e
commit
|
commitdiff
|
tree
2007-08-30
Stathis K
a
mpe
r
is
Fix
a
m
e
mory le
a
k in slinkedlist
.
c file
commit
|
commitdiff
|
tree
2007-08-24
Stathis Ka
m
p
e
ris
Simplify
i
nsert
i
on of
items i
n
tai
l
q
commit
|
commitdiff
|
tree
2007-08-24
Stat
h
is Ka
m
peris
R
e
gener
a
te CO
N
TENTS file
commit
|
commitdiff
|
tree
2007-08-24
Stathis Kamp
e
ris
Revert "Regenerate CONT
E
N
T
S f
i
le to include tailq
.
c
"
commit
|
commitdiff
|
tree
2007-08-24
S
tathis Ka
m
p
e
ris
Regenerate C
O
NTE
N
TS fi
l
e
to include t
a
ilq
.
c
commit
|
commitdiff
|
tree
2007-08-24
Stathi
s
Ka
m
p
e
ris
Add coment in reverse trav
e
rsal in
tailq
.
c
commit
|
commitdiff
|
tree
2007-08-24
Stath
i
s Kamperis
Initia
l
import
o
f tailq
.
c
commit
|
commitdiff
|
tree
2007-08-24
Stathis Kamp
e
r
is
Remov
e
bogus poi
n
ter to head of list
commit
|
commitdiff
|
tree
2007-08-24
St
a
thi
s
Kamperis
Fix a typo
commit
|
commitdiff
|
tree
2007-08-24
Stath
i
s Ka
m
peris
Convert do
u
ble link
e
d list to sin
g
led linked list
commit
|
commitdiff
|
tree
2007-08-15
St
a
t
h
is Kam
p
eris
Add miss
i
n
g
unistd
.
h
h
e
ade
r
file
commit
|
commitdiff
|
tree
2007-08-15
Stathis K
a
mperis
siz
e
of op
e
rand pare
n
thesiz
e
d
only if a typed
name
commit
|
commitdiff
|
tree
2007-08-15
Sta
t
his
K
amperis
Fi
x
some comments
and don't print spaces in ata model
commit
|
commitdiff
|
tree
2007-08-13
S
t
athis Kamperis
R
evert "
.
c
files don't need
to be +x"
commit
|
commitdiff
|
tree
2007-08-13
Stathis Kamperis
.
c
files
d
on't need
to be +x
commit
|
commitdiff
|
tree
2007-08-13
Stathis
K
am
p
er
i
s
Don't s
o
r
t
in list
.
sh
and update
C
ONTENTS file
commit
|
commitdiff
|
tree
2007-08-13
S
t
athi
s
Kampe
r
is
Update CONT
E
NTS file
commit
|
commitdiff
|
tree
2007-08-13
Sta
t
his Kamperis
List a
l
l
.
c fil
e
s in tree
commit
|
commitdiff
|
tree
2007-08-13
Stath
i
s Kamperis
Add CONTENTS file to
l
i
s
t all C code snippets
i
n
tr
e
e
commit
|
commitdiff
|
tree
2007-08-13
Stathis Ka
m
peris
U
p
d
ate TODO fil
e
commit
|
commitdiff
|
tree
2007-08-13
Stathis Kam
p
eris
D
e
scribe kqdir
.
c
commit
|
commitdiff
|
tree
2007-08-13
St
a
th
i
s Kamperi
s
Describe kqtime
r
.
c prog
r
am
commit
|
commitdiff
|
tree
2007-08-13
Stathis Kamperis
Des
c
ribe kqclient
.
c
progra
m
commit
|
commitdiff
|
tree
2007-08-13
Stathis Ka
m
per
i
s
Des
c
ri
b
e echo_off
.
c
progra
m
commit
|
commitdiff
|
tree
2007-08-13
Stat
h
is Kamperis
Add description regarding disklabel
.
c
and readwd
.
c
.
.
.
commit
|
commitdiff
|
tree
2007-08-13
Stathis
K
amp
e
ris
Fix permissions of
TODO file to
7
55
commit
|
commitdiff
|
tree
next